Disguise: pro-life people only care about mothers until the baby is born, abandoning them after the fact. Truth: 18 states currently fund life-affirming alternatives to abortion, and over 3,000 pregnancy resource centers and maternity homes nationwide serve women during pregnancy and long after their child is born. In 2022, pro-life centers provided over $350 million in services at no cost to the woman. Eight in ten Americans support pregnancy centers and agree our laws can protect both mother and child.
